Charge and Turn On Your Fitbit Versa 4
Before exploring how to use a Fitbit Versa 4, you must power it up correctly. The device supports fast charging, giving you a full day of battery life in just 12 minutes.
Connect the Charging Cable
Attach the magnetic charging cable to the back of your watch by aligning the pins carefully. Plug the USB end into a power source such as a wall charger. A battery icon appears on screen when charging begins.
Pro Tip: Use a wall charger instead of a laptop USB port for faster charging speeds.
Once charging completes, press and hold the side button to power on the device. The Fitbit logo appears followed by setup prompts guiding you through the initial configuration.
Check Battery Status Anytime
Swipe down from the clock face to open the Quick Settings menu. Tap the battery tile to see your current charge level. To extend battery life, reduce screen brightness or disable the always-on display feature.
Set Up Your Device with the Google Health App
Your Fitbit Versa 4 works with the Google Health app, which syncs all your health and fitness data. This app replaced the older Fitbit app and is essential for using your watch.
Create or Sign In to Your Google Account
Open the Google Health app on your iPhone or Android device. If you do not already have a Google account, create one during setup. This account is required to activate your Versa 4 and access all features.
Important: Existing Fitbit users must transfer their account to Google. Go to Account Settings in the app to begin the transfer process.
Pair Your Watch via Bluetooth
Ensure Bluetooth is enabled on your phone. Follow the in-app prompts to pair your Versa 4, keeping the watch close to your phone during the process. If pairing fails, restart both devices and ensure no other Fitbit devices are nearby.
Navigate the Versa 4 Interface
Mastering navigation is essential when learning how to use a Fitbit Versa 4 efficiently. The interface uses simple swipe gestures and button presses.
Browse Your Daily Stats Tiles
From the clock face, swipe left or right to view tiles showing your daily information. These tiles include heart rate, steps taken, sleep score, weather, Active Zone Minutes, and SpO2 blood oxygen levels. Tap any tile to see detailed information, then swipe up to return to the clock face.
Use the Side Button for Apps and Shortcuts
Press the side button once to open the app menu. Scroll through apps such as Exercise, Relax, Wallet, and Settings. Double-press the button to access shortcuts including your voice assistant, notifications, quick settings, and Wallet. Hold the button to launch your favorite customizable app.
Customize Your Watch Face
Personalizing your watch face keeps your device fresh and functional while displaying the information matters most to you.
Select Preloaded Clock Faces
Open the Google Health app, go to the Today tab, tap your device image, then select Clock Face. Browse categories including analog, digital, activity-focused, and weather-integrated designs. Tap any face to preview and apply it.
Download Additional Clock Faces
Visit the Clock Face Gallery in the app to download free or premium designs. Some options display battery level, heart rate, or calendar events directly on your watch face.
Track Workouts Automatically and Manually

Your Versa 4 captures every movement whether you start tracking manually or let the device detect your activity automatically.
Start a Workout Manually
Open the Exercise app from the app menu. Scroll to select your activity such as Run, Walk, Bike, or Swim. Tap to start and wait for GPS lock if exercising outdoors. During exercise, swipe left to view time elapsed, heart rate zone, pace, distance, and calories burned. Press the side button to pause or end your workout.
Enable Auto-Detection for Activities
Turn on SmartTrack in the Google Health app by navigating to Today, your device, Exercise, then Auto-Recognize Activities. When enabled, your watch automatically detects and records walking, running, or cycling sessions lasting 15 minutes or longer. Review these activities in the app later.
Monitor Your Health Metrics Daily

Your Versa 4 tracks extensive health data beyond simple step counting, giving you insights into your overall well-being.
Check Your Stress Management Score
Find your daily Stress Management Score in the Google Health app. This score uses your resting heart rate, sleep quality, and activity levels to determine how your body responds to stress. Lower scores indicate higher stress levels.
Use the Relax App for Breathing Exercises
Open the Relax app on your watch. Choose a session length between 2 and 5 minutes. Follow the on-screen breathing prompts to practice guided breathing. Rate how you feel afterward to track stress improvements over time.
View Blood Oxygen Trends
Your watch measures SpO2 overnight using built-in sensors. In the Google Health app, navigate to Today, Sleep, then SpO2 to view trends. Normal readings range from 95 to 100%. Consistently low readings may indicate poor sleep quality.
Receive and Manage Notifications
Stay connected without constantly checking your phone by enabling smart notifications on your Versa 4.
Enable Phone Notifications
In the Google Health app, go to Today, tap your device, then select Notifications. Toggle on calls, texts, calendar events, and app alerts. Choose which specific apps can send notifications to your watch. Swipe up from the clock face to view incoming alerts.
Respond to Messages on Android
If paired with an Android phone, you can reply to text messages directly from your watch. Swipe right on a message and choose a preset quick reply or use voice-to-text to dictate your response. Note that iPhone users can only view messages without replying.
Use Smart Daily Features
Your Versa 4 simplifies everyday tasks beyond fitness tracking, making it a convenient companion throughout your day.
Make Contactless Payments
Add your credit or debit card by opening Google Health app, going to Today, selecting Wallet, then tapping Add Card. Follow verification steps to complete setup. To pay, press and hold the side button, select your card, and hold your watch near the payment terminal.
Find Your Phone Instantly
Cannot find your phone? Open the Find Phone app on your watch and tap Ring. Your phone rings loudly even if set to silent, helping you locate it quickly within your home or office.
Get Turn-by-Turn Directions
Use Google Maps on your wrist by opening the Maps app, searching for a destination, and starting navigation. Receive vibrations for turns and spoken directions through your phone. Keep your phone nearby as navigation runs through the connected device.
Maximize Battery Life
The Fitbit Versa 4 lasts up to 6 days on a single charge, though actual battery life depends on your usage patterns.
Adjust Settings to Extend Battery
In Settings, navigate to Battery and enable Battery Saver Mode to turn off non-essential features during workouts. Reduce screen timeout duration and disable always-on display to save significant power. Limiting app notifications and reducing haptic feedback also helps extend battery life.
Charge Efficiently
Use fast charging when short on time, as 12 minutes provides approximately 24 hours of battery life. For best results, charge your device overnight to start each day with a full battery.
Troubleshoot Common Issues
Even reliable devices occasionally experience problems. Here are solutions for frequent issues when learning how to use a Fitbit Versa 4.
Fix Syncing Problems
If your watch is not syncing properly, restart both watch and phone. Ensure Bluetooth remains enabled on your phone. Force close and reopen the Google Health app, then attempt to sync again. If problems persist, go to Bluetooth settings, forget the device, and re-pair from scratch.
Recover a Frozen Screen
If your watch screen becomes unresponsive, press and hold the side button for 15 seconds. Wait for the Fitbit logo to appear, then release. The device reboots without erasing your data.
Reset to Factory Settings
For a fresh start, back up your data first. In the Google Health app, go to Today, tap your device, then select Unpair. On your watch, navigate to Settings, System, Reset, then Erase All Data. After resetting, pair again as a new device.
Frequently Asked Questions About Using Fitbit Versa 4
How do I set up my Fitbit Versa 4 for the first time?
To set up your Versa 4, first charge it using the included magnetic cable. Then download the Google Health app on your phone, create or sign in to a Google account, and follow the in-app prompts to pair your watch via Bluetooth.
Can I reply to text messages on Fitbit Versa 4?
Yes, Android users can reply to text messages using preset quick replies or voice-to-text dictation. iPhone users can only view messages without the ability to reply directly from the watch.
How long does the Fitbit Versa 4 battery last?
The Versa 4 battery lasts up to 6 days on a single charge, depending on usage. Features like always-on display, GPS tracking, and frequent notifications reduce battery life faster.
Does Fitbit Versa 4 have GPS?
Yes, the Versa 4 has built-in GPS, allowing you to track outdoor workouts accurately without carrying your phone.
How do I track my sleep with Fitbit Versa 4?
Your watch automatically tracks sleep overnight. View your sleep score and details in the Google Health app under the Today tab and Sleep section.
